It would be nice to have the printer location or room number displayed in the shares list when browsing a samba print server.

Currently the location is only displayed on the "Printer and Faxes" page, where users are not able to double click a printer to install it.

Is it possible to combine the comment and location field into one for display when listing the printers on the shares page?

I tried to manually add the location info into the comment field of the printer properties but this did not change what is displayed in the comments column on the shares list. See the first printer (agnon) in the screenshots.

Is this a Windows XP client issue or a server side issue?

Right, in fact retrieving location and comment from cups was broken completely in 3.5 and got fixed in bug #8132. Now we need to think how we can address the location/comment display in the sharelist as well.
